IP查询
查询
你查询的IP:[118.89.153.64] 地理位置:中国–上海–上海
最新查询
114.28.118.81
221.172.55.32
120.52.28.100
60.238.70.32
61.28.148.195
121.40.56.216
222.192.118.8
124.128.206.118
116.204.17.21
118.89.153.64
202.90.224.145
117.48.46.23
119.57.71.162
124.42.158.186
120.80.44.203
118.64.247.97
203.81.16.254
117.32.16.74
203.92.160.32
119.18.224.249
124.172.245.154
211.64.20.158
124.254.72.131
220.192.89.248
222.192.202.147
116.69.16.168
203.93.95.20
218.192.228.209
192.124.154.38
116.69.149.190
60.245.128.139